The postcode OL10 2BH is located in Rochdale, in the county of Greater Manchester.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. OL10 2BH is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
OL10 2BH is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 2.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of OL10 2BH as Hard-pressed living > Industrious communities > Industrious hardship.
The closest road name to OL10 2BH is Buttermere Avenue which is centered 16 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Walton Street and is 201 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 705 m away at Heywood (East Lancashire Railway) The closest railway station is Castleton (Manchester) Rail Station, 2.53 km away.
The closest primary school to OL10 2BH (for ages 11 and under) is Hopwood Community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Outstanding on October 9, 2008.
The local pub for residents of OL10 2BH is Hopwood Unionist Club and is 350 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on October 19,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from McNallys Bistro and is 0 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on March 10, 2021.
Residents reported an average download speed of 73.8 Mbps and an average upload speed of 8.6 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 63%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 96.3%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 3.7%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.9 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for OL10 2BH is covered by the Greater Manchester police force association and Heywood, Middleton and Rochdale is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
